Study Summary

We hypothesize that premature infants who receive their mothers' expressed breast milk supplemented with liquid protein early in their hospitalization will have a growth velocity in the first 28 days of life that is 20% greater than the growth velocity of premature infants that do not receive protein fortification.

Interventions

  • DIETARY_SUPPLEMENT liquid protein supplement
